Job Duties
This position plays a critical role in ensuring smooth day-to-day operations by providing organized, proactive, and detail-oriented support to the CCA. This position is designed to enhance efficiency by managing administrative tasks and maintaining essential office functions. The Administrative Assistant fosters a professional and well-structured work environment, serving as a central point for coordination and operational effectiveness.
Minimum Qualifications
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ities (KSAs)
* Knowledge of administrative office practices, procedures, and workflow management.
* Knowledge of records management principles and retention requirements for both digital and physical files.
* Understanding of calendar management, scheduling protocols, and meeting logistics for executive-level personnel.
* Knowledge of statutory or regulatory posting requirements for public meetings, agendas, and notices.
* Strong written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to draft clear reports, correspondence, minutes, and presentations.
* High-level organizational and time management skills, including prioritizing multiple tasks and meeting deadlines.
* Skill in using Microsoft 365 (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int), document management systems, and shared platforms.
* Skill in coordinating projects, managing logistics, and supporting multidepartment workflows.
* Skill in proofreading, formatting, and ensuring accuracy in official documents.
* Ability to independently organize workflows, maintain filing systems, and implement administrative procedures.
* Ability to support cross departmental initiatives and facilitate efficient information flow.
* Ability to manage travel arrangements, process reimbursements, and ensure adherence to policies.
* Ability to handle mult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ment while maintaining accuracy and attention to detail.
* Ability to use critical thinking to anticipate needs, resolve issues proactively, and support team productivity.
Experience
* Minimum of 2-3 years of experience providing administrative, executive, or program support in a professional office environment.
* Experience must include responsibility for scheduling, document preparation, meeting coordination, recordkeeping, and communication with internal and external stakeholders.
* Experience managing sensitive information with confidentiality and handling mult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ment is required.
